Hoops: Give These Girls a High Five
Sports Editor Ron Kremer ranks the top area girls basketball teams from 1-5, plus the five knocking on the door.
1. Marian Catholic (25-4): Spartans take down Trinity 57-49 behind a game-high 19 points from Simone Law. And that was just the week’s appetizer. Next: Friday vs. Fenwick.
2. Lincoln-Way East (20-5): Taylor Johnson lights up Homewood-Flossmoor with 33-point performance as the Griffins notch a 62-51 victory. And now some are wondering, "Kelly who?" Next: Tonight vs. Lockport.
3. Marist (24-4): Randyll Butler's 8-footer at the buzzer boosted the RedHawks to a thrilling 65-63 victory over Fenwick. No better way to prepare for playoffs. Next: Tonight at Trinity.
4. Homewood-Flossmoor (19-6): Charnelle Reed scored 22 points in the Vikings' loss to Lincoln-Way East. She had 13 points and three rebounds earlier as H-F rallied from 10-0 deficit to tip Sandburg 41-37. Next: Tonight at Lincoln-Way Central.
5. Andrew (22-2): Nicole Botich and Molly Franson lead T-Bolts to back-to-back wins over Lincoln-Way North and Thornridge. Next: Tonight vs. Thornwood.
Next best (in alphabetical order): Lincoln-Way North, Mother McAuley, Oak Forest, Richards, Rich South.
